There's not necessarily any new information in this book that isn't on the internet, but having it all in one place and spelled out very easily is incredibly valuable.I followed that full 12-week program which resulted in some lost weight, increased strength, and more muscle tone! More importantly I feel like it helped me develop a habit of working out that I intend to continue.Pros:- All exercises are described fully.- If an exercise is unable to be performed, several alternatives are mentioned.- It touches on many different aspects of working out. Eating healthy, which supplements are worth it, stretching, etc.- Hard to beat that price.Cons:- Why aren't the page numbers for the exercise included in the workout plan? You literally have the page numbers in the index of the book, it wouldn't have been hard to add them to the workout plan. Instead I have to flip back and forth, or write in the page number myself.- Wish it would've expanded more on the nutrition side.

NIce book but too complex a program for beginners
The book has an excellent presentation with a good description of the exercises. However, what I found frustrating is that the workout plan includes circuits that require several machines. As a newbie at the gym, I feel uncomfortable reserving up to 4 machines for a circuit. Without the exercise plan, the rest of the content describing the exercises and the few pages on nutrition can be found on pretty much any bodybuilding blog for free.

Perfect for those who want to get in shape
Today I finished the 12-week program. I learned a ton about weight lifting; including how to do the many workouts, when to do them, when to take days off, calculating the volume of a workout, the difference between strength building and muscle building, and more. I didn’t think I could follow the workout schedule but I did, and it is possible for anyone, even working a full time job with overtime. I plan on keeping up with the workouts now that I finished the program. There are noticeable differences in my body from day 1 to now. Great book!
